San Diego SPJ’s Final Election Results

SPJ San Diego congratulates incumbent Tom Jones of NBC 7 San Diego for winning another two-year term on the SPJ board after an uprecendented runoff election last week.

The board also voted Tuesday to select its officers for the new year.

Voice of San Diego reporter Lisa Halverstadt will remain president and Jones, executive investigative producer for NBC 7, will serve as vice president. Bey-Ling Sha, director of SDSU’s School of Journalism and Media Studies, will serve as secretary and Andrew Kleske, reader outreach editor at the San Diego Union-Tribune, will stay on as treasurer.
